Most tools focus on just one utilityโBitly for links, DocSend for document analytics, DocuSign for contracts, and WeTransfer for temporary file sends. Paperspur unifies all these into a single, premium, privacy-first dashboard. Furthermore, our SpurShare feature is unique: it allows zero-storage browser-to-browser P2P file transfers up to 100MB via WebRTC. The files stream directly between devices and never touch our servers, providing absolute security and privacy with zero trace.
Cost Efficiency: Instead of paying $150+/month for DocSend or DocuSign, you get PDF gating, contract signing, and data rooms in one place for a fraction of the cost. Absolute Privacy: With WebRTC P2P sharing and AES-256 encrypted vaults, you retain total ownership. We host data in the EU and do not sell user analytics. Actionable Analytics: Get visual page-by-page reader focus timelines and heatmaps so you know exactly which sections of your proposal or pitch deck captured a prospect's attention. Developer Integration: Custom branded domains, webhook configurations, and API keys are built-in from day one.

I built Paperspur out of frustration with expensive software bills and data privacy concessions. I found subscribing to multiple expensive SaaS platforms to simply share pitch decks and sign contracts. I realized I could build a unified, security-first document workspace. During development, to solve the massive cloud storage overhead of temporary user file transfers, I built a WebRTC chunking relay. This allowed users to transfer files up to 100MB directly browser-to-browser (SpurShare), keeping our cloud storage bills at $0 and user data completely private.
Backend: FastAPI (Python), WebSockets (for WebRTC signaling and ICE relays), PostgreSQL SQLite, and Redis. Frontend: Vanilla HTML5, CSS3 (with responsive custom properties), and native Javascript (using browser WebRTC APIs and pdf.js for document rendering and focus tracking). Self-Hosting: Docker and Docker Compose.
